Layoutlib: Read and close XML files as soon as possible.
Because passing an InputStream to KXML does not close the stream after the file has been parsed, the files are staying locked on windows until the gc and finalizers are run. This change preload the XML files and close their stream, and then pass the content in a stream to the parser. Change-Id: Iabe27989dc616ec9e7de88e52b1ec3af9f007f7c
